Have you ever wondered what the cube root of 27 is? It’s a common mathematical question that may seem tricky at first glance, but with a little explanation, it becomes quite simple to understand.
When we talk about the cube root of a number, we are looking for a number that, when multiplied by itself three times, gives us the original number. In the case of 27, the cube root is 3 because 3 x 3 x 3 equals 27.
